
Scottish outdoor clothing brand, Keela, has achieved further success, with the brand’s Arran Jacket winning the Eco Award at Slide & OTS (Outdoor Trade Show) Winter 2025.
Positioned as a ‘timeless classic infused with modern functionality’, the jacket is made in the UK with locally sourced fabrics and produced in Keela’s Fife-based factory. The Arran utilises Halley Stevenson waxed cotton, which balances durability, breathability, and water resistance and is created using sustainable manufacturing processes, and HD Wool Evolve Active, which provides renewable, biodegradable warmth in the harshest conditions, combining sustainability with high performance. The result is a waxed cotton shell, providing a naturally weatherproof barrier, with the robust weave ensuring reliable durability.
The win was announced at Slide & OTS Winter, the UK winter trade show for snow sport and outdoor enthusiasts, with the awards designed to reward exhibiting brands for technical innovation and excellence. Winners were announced in front of exhibitors, SIGB members and the media, with the Eco Award judged by Protect Our Winters (POW), a non-profit organisation that helps passionate outdoor people protect the places and experiences they love from climate change.
The awards are spread across seven different categories: Accessories, Outdoor Clothing, Outdoor Hardware, Snowsports Clothing, Snowsport Hardware, a ‘Fresh Brand’ category open only to first-time exhibitors/brands at the show, and the aforementioned ‘Eco Award’ category for brands that show particular environmentally friendly credentials.
